PFAS and legacy chemical litigation
PFAS lawsuits, asbestos claims, Superfund liability, legacy contamination disputes. Chemicals companies face litigation that spans decades, involves thousands of plaintiffs, and costs billions. When a single chemical class can generate a generation of litigation, your outside counsel cost management has to be as durable as the exposure itself.
Supply chain disruption & trade compliance
Export controls, sanctions compliance, tariff disputes, force majeure claims, and supplier litigation. Industrial companies operate global supply chains under increasing geopolitical pressure. Managing trade counsel across dozens of jurisdictions without a structured process isn't governance — it's exposure.
Environmental remediation & regulatory enforcement
EPA enforcement actions, state environmental proceedings, REACH compliance, remediation obligations. Environmental regulatory work in the chemicals sector is perpetual and multi-jurisdictional. Information Security Management
Certified against the current version of the international ISMS standard. Independently audited. Not self-assessed.
Audited Controls
SOC 1 Type 2 attested. SOC 2 report available under NDA via the PERSUIT Trust Center — alongside pentest report, network diagram, and data flow documentation.
Cloud Security
Cloud Security Alliance STAR certified. Hosted on Google Cloud. SecurityScorecard: A. UpGuard: 865/950. Third-party scores, independently assigned.
SSO & Role-Based Permissions
SSO support. Role-based access controls. Full audit logging on every platform action. Your matter data is strictly isolated — no cross-customer data access, ever.
BC/DR & Data Governance
Business Continuity and Disaster Recovery policy in place with tested contingency planning. Encryption policy, acceptable use policy, and full data chain of custody documentation available.
